GPT-5.2 Model Explained: Pro, Thinking, Instant and What’s New in OpenAI’s Latest Upgrade

GPT 5.2 model: What’s New in Pro, Thinking, and Instant
GPT-5.2 model updates mark OpenAI’s newest publicly announced GPT family (December 2025), aimed squarely at everyday professional work that still demands serious brainpower. If GPT-5.1 emphasized steerability and stronger coding behavior, GPT-5.2 pushes further into complex, multi-step workflows, better visual understanding, and more efficient long-context handling.
GPT 5.2 model upgrades in 2025
The lineup is designed to fit different job shapes. GPT-5.2 Pro targets heavy-duty scientific assistance and difficult reasoning tasks, while GPT-5.2 Thinking is built for deeper analysis when problems get messy. GPT-5.2 Instant focuses on speed and responsiveness for routine work without sacrificing quality. Together, these variants reflect a clear direction: specialized models that integrate more smoothly into real professional pipelines.
GPT 5.2 model vision improvements for charts and dashboards
One of the most practical upgrades is vision. GPT-5.2 is described as roughly halving error rates in understanding charts, dashboards, diagrams, and software interfaces. That matters when your “document” is really a KPI dashboard, a product analytics screenshot, or a workflow diagram that needs interpretation rather than transcription.
GPT 5.2 model reasoning: xhigh effort and concise summaries
On the reasoning side, GPT-5.2 introduces a new xhigh effort level for deeper analysis, paired with concise reasoning summaries to keep outputs readable. This combination aims to support both rigorous thinking and clearer communication—useful when you need decisions, not dissertations.
GPT 5.2 model context compaction for long workflows
For long-running tasks, GPT-5.2 adds context compaction, improving how the model carries forward key details across extended sessions. And in science-oriented evaluations, GPT-5.2 Pro is positioned as especially strong, including high performance on challenging benchmarks such as GPQA Diamond.
In short, GPT-5.2 is framed as OpenAI’s most advanced model family for professional productivity: sharper vision, deeper reasoning options, and better endurance for complex work.

OxygenOS 16.1 Features: Massive UI Redesign, Camera Upgrade, and Smarter Notifications

OxygenOS 16.1 features are shaping up to be one of the biggest updates for OnePlus users, bringing a refreshed design, improved usability, and smarter system interactions. Based on early changelogs and previews, this update focuses heavily on refining the user experience rather than just adding surface-level changes.
OxygenOS 16.1 Features: Revamped User Interface and Design
One of the biggest highlights of OxygenOS 16.1 is its completely redesigned interface. The lock screen now features a stacked notification layout, making alerts easier to read and manage. Notifications appear more structured and can be interacted with smoothly using gestures.
Additionally, a new pill-shaped interactive element appears at the bottom of the screen. This allows users to quickly access controls like music playback, with smooth animations that enhance the overall fluidity of the system. The update also brings noticeable improvements in animation consistency, making everyday interactions feel faster and more responsive.
OxygenOS 16.1 Features: Camera App Overhaul Explained
The camera application has been completely revamped with a focus on simplicity and efficiency. According to early information, the new design aims to make photography more intuitive while offering better accessibility to key controls.
While detailed visuals are still limited, the redesign is expected to enhance usability for both casual users and content creators. The goal is to streamline the shooting experience without compromising on advanced features.

OxygenOS 16.1 Features: Smarter Notifications and Enhancements
OxygenOS 16.1 introduces a redesigned notification center with support for quick replies and improved organization. Notifications are now more interactive and visually structured, helping users manage multiple alerts efficiently.
The update also builds on previous improvements seen in OxygenOS 16.0.5, such as enhanced controls in the Photos app. Users can now adjust video playback speed directly from the interface, along with a refined progress bar and better layout for editing tools.
Expected Rollout Timeline
The rollout of OxygenOS 16.1 is expected to begin shortly after ColorOS 16.1 launches, which is scheduled to start around late April. Flagship devices are likely to receive the update first, followed by other supported models.

OPPO Find X9 Ultra Specs Leak: Dual 200MP Cameras, Hasselblad Tuning and Flagship Power

OPPO Find X9 Ultra brings next-gen camera innovation
The OPPO Find X9 Ultra is shaping up to be one of the most ambitious flagship smartphones of 2026. According to recent leaks, the device is expected to focus heavily on camera innovation, performance, and battery life, making it a strong contender in the premium segment.
Dual 200MP Hasselblad Cameras Take Center Stage
One of the biggest highlights of the OPPO Find X9 Ultra is its rumored dual 200MP camera system developed in collaboration with Hasselblad. This setup is expected to include advanced periscope zoom capabilities, potentially offering up to 10x optical zoom.
Such a configuration could significantly enhance long-range photography while maintaining high detail and color accuracy. OPPO’s continued partnership with Hasselblad suggests improvements in color science and professional-grade image processing.

Flagship Performance and Display
Under the hood, the device is expected to feature a next-generation Snapdragon chipset, likely delivering top-tier performance for gaming, multitasking, and AI-driven tasks. Alongside this, the phone may sport a 2K LTPO display with adaptive refresh rates, ensuring both smooth visuals and power efficiency.
Massive Battery and Premium Build
Battery life is another area where the OPPO Find X9 Ultra could stand out. Leaks suggest a large battery capacity of around 7000mAh, which would be significantly higher than most flagship devices currently available. This could translate into extended usage without frequent charging.
In terms of design, OPPO is expected to continue its premium approach with a refined build quality and a visually striking camera module.
Launch Timeline
The OPPO Find X9 Ultra is expected to launch first in China on April 21, with a broader global rollout anticipated shortly after.

Google Gemini 3D Models and Charts: Powerful New AI Feature That Transforms Visual Learning

Google Gemini 3D models and charts are redefining how users interact with artificial intelligence by transforming plain text responses into dynamic visual experiences. With this latest update from Google, the Gemini app is no longer limited to answering questions—it can now visually demonstrate concepts through interactive models and data charts.
Google Gemini 3D Models: A New Era of Interactive AI
The new feature allows users to generate interactive 3D models directly within the Gemini app. Whether it is understanding planetary motion, physics simulations, or complex systems, users can now explore concepts visually rather than relying solely on text explanations.
Alongside 3D models, Gemini also introduces real-time chart generation. Users can input data or ask questions, and the AI instantly creates charts that can be adjusted using sliders and controls. This makes data interpretation faster and far more intuitive.
How Google Gemini 3D Models Improve Learning and Visualization
This update is particularly useful for students, educators, and professionals who rely on visual learning. Instead of imagining abstract concepts, users can now see them in action, leading to better understanding and retention.
For professionals, especially in data-driven fields, the ability to quickly generate and manipulate charts can significantly improve productivity. It eliminates the need for separate tools and simplifies workflows by keeping everything within a single AI interface.
